Godfather's Pizza, located at 1500 Monticello Rd in Madison, GA, underwent a low-risk inspection on January 9, 2026, with a score of 90. This inspection noted two minor violations related to personal cleanliness and nonfood-contact surfaces. Previous inspections for this food service establishment have primarily been medium-risk.
